How to Attach a Race Number Bib: Aerodynamic Details That Cut Drag
In the preparation for a cycling race, handling the race number bib is often overlooked. But for riders chasing peak performance, how the bib is attached and folded can produce a measurable speed improvement without spending a single dollar.

Why Does a Race Number Bib Affect Speed?
The Sail Effect
A standard-size race number bib (roughly 21x30cm, A4 size) can act like a sail while riding:
- Large surface area facing the wind
- Paper material is relatively stiff and tends to curl into a convex shape
- Fixed at the four corners but slack in the middle, so it billows in the wind
Wind tunnel data shows that an untreated, billowing bib can add roughly 3-5W of aerodynamic drag at 40km/h, and even more at 50km/h.
The Best Ways to Attach a Race Number Bib
Method 1: Multi-Point Fixing
Traditionally, only 4 safety pins are used at the corners, which lets the middle of the bib billow in the wind. Improved approach:
Steps:
- Fix the four corners (standard)
- Add 1 safety pin along each of the four edges (8 total)
- Add 1 pin along each diagonal in the middle (10 total)
The more safety pins used, the more closely the bib hugs the jersey, and the lower the drag.
Method 2: Folding (Most Effective)
Many professional cyclists and triathletes use folding to reduce the effective surface area of the bib:
Steps:
- Starting from the edge of the bib, fold inward (without covering the number itself)
- Reduce the surface area while keeping the number fully visible
- A folded bib is stiffer and less likely to billow
Note: The fold must never obscure the number, or you risk disqualification.
Method 3: High-Tack Double-Sided Tape
Use double-sided tape (especially fabric tape) on the back of the bib to attach it directly to the jersey:
Pros: Full, flush contact and minimal drag
Cons: May damage the jersey when peeled off — it’s best to remove it immediately after the race
Choosing Where to Place the Bib
Back vs. Waist
| Position | Aero Effect | Visibility | Common Use |
|---|---|---|---|
| Center back | Average | High | Road race group events |
| Side of back | Better | Moderate | Triathlon |
| Waist (helmet-shielded) | Best (shielded by the helmet) | Low | Time trials |
| Front chest (triathlon) | Poor (faces the wind head-on) | Highest | Required for the run leg |
Special Requirements for Triathlon
A triathlon race belt wraps around the waist and can be quickly rotated from back to front (back during the swim and bike legs, front during the run leg). This belt-style design offers more of an aerodynamic advantage than safety pins, and is also more practical.
Advanced Tips: Choosing the Right Bib Material
Some races allow or require specific bib materials:
| Material | Characteristics | Aero Effect |
|---|---|---|
| Paper bib | Most common, cheap | Worse (prone to billowing) |
| Tyvek | Waterproof and lightweight | Moderate |
| Aero bib (provided by sponsor) | Form-fitting design | Best |
Some sponsors or major events (such as IRONMAN) provide official form-fitting bib sleeves that fit directly over the jersey for the best result.
Special Notes for Time Trials
Individual time trials (TT) demand the most from aerodynamics, so here are recommendations for handling the bib:
- TT skinsuits: One-piece TT skinsuits usually have a built-in pocket-style slot for the bib, completely eliminating any flapping
- Bib on the side of the helmet: Some races allow the bib to be attached to the side of the helmet, keeping it off the body entirely
- Check the rules in advance: Every race has different rules for bib placement and size
Quick Summary
For most amateur cyclists, the most practical improvements are:
- Use multiple safety pins (not just the 4 corners)
- Keep the bib as flush against the jersey as possible, with no gaps
- Consider using a race number belt (for triathlon)
These zero-cost details can add up to more of an advantage than expected over a long-distance race. This attention to detail is part of what separates professional riders from amateurs.
